My Buying Guides on Toddler Girl Snow Boots
Why I Pay Attention to Snow Boots for Toddler Girls
When I shop for toddler girl snow boots, I focus on comfort, warmth, and safety first. My experience has shown me that little feet need boots that are easy to put on, stay dry in snow, and give enough grip on slippery ground. I always look for boots that can handle cold weather without feeling too heavy or stiff for a toddler.
My Top Features to Look For
I check a few important features before I buy. I want insulation to keep feet warm, waterproof material to block slush and snow, and a secure closure like Velcro or easy pull-on handles. I also make sure the sole has good traction, because I want my toddler to walk more safely on icy paths or wet sidewalks.
How I Choose the Right Size
For me, sizing matters a lot. I usually choose a little extra room for warm socks, but I avoid boots that are too loose because they can make walking awkward. I like to measure my toddler’s feet and compare them with the brand’s size chart. If I am unsure, I often read reviews to see whether the boots run small or large.
What I Look For in Warmth and Comfort
I prefer boots with soft lining and enough insulation for winter weather. My goal is to keep my toddler’s feet warm without making the boots bulky. I also pay attention to flexibility, because I want her to move naturally while playing, walking, or running in the snow.
Why Waterproofing Is Important to Me
I always choose boots that can resist water well. Snow often turns into wet slush, and I do not want my toddler’s socks getting damp. In my experience, waterproof boots are worth it because they help keep feet dry and comfortable for longer outings.
My Thoughts on Easy On and Off Design
I love boots that make dressing simpler. Toddler girls usually do better with boots that have wide openings, pull tabs, or Velcro straps. I find that easy-on designs save time and reduce frustration, especially when we are getting ready to go out quickly.
How I Check Traction and Safety
I always inspect the outsole before buying. A deep tread pattern gives better grip, and I prefer soles that feel sturdy but not overly heavy. This gives me more confidence when my toddler is walking on snow, ice, or muddy winter ground.
My Preference for Lightweight Boots
In my experience, lighter boots are easier for toddlers to wear. Heavy boots can make little legs tired faster, so I try to find a pair that offers warmth and protection without too much weight. This helps my toddler stay active and comfortable.
